GAME PREVIEW: Heat take on Lakers in NBA Finals rematch

The Miami Heat (12-17) will try to get their second straight win on their West Coast trip when they face the Los Angeles Lakers (22-8) tonight in a nationally televised game on ABC. The two teams have not played each other since the NBA Finals in the Orlando bubble.
